The cheapest way to get from Cambridge to Little Downham is to drive which costs £4 - £7 and takes 29 min.
The fastest way to get from Cambridge to Little Downham is to train and taxi which takes 25 min and costs £17 - £30.
No, there is no direct bus from Cambridge station to Little Downham. However, there are services departing from Drummer St Bus Station and arriving at School Lane via Market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 3m.
The distance between Cambridge and Little Downham is 18 miles. The road distance is 19.8 miles.
The best way to get from Cambridge to Little Downham without a car is to train and taxi which takes 25 min and costs £17 - £30.
It takes approximately 25 min to get from Cambridge to Little Downham, including transfers.
Cambridge to Little Downham bus services, operated by A2B Bus & Coach (Royston), depart from Drummer St Bus Station.
Cambridge to Little Downham bus services, operated by A2B Bus & Coach (Royston), arrive at Market Street station.
Yes, the driving distance between Cambridge to Little Downham is 20 miles. It takes approximately 29 min to drive from Cambridge to Little Downham.
